Senate Bill 60
2019-2020 Regular Session
An Act amending Titles 18 (Crimes and Offenses) and 42 (Judiciary and Judicial Procedure) of the Pennsylvania Consolidated Statutes, in human trafficking, further providing for the offense of trafficking in individuals, for the offense of patronizing a victim of sexual servitude and for asset forfeiture; and, in depositions and witnesses, further providing for definitions.
